Jimmy Webb is a Grammy Award-winning American songwriter, composer, and singer whose career spans over five decades, establishing him as one of the most significant figures in contemporary music. His compositions are celebrated for their intricate melodies, sophisticated arrangements, and poignant storytelling. Webb is the only artist to have received Grammy Awards for music, lyrics, and orchestration. His catalog boasts an astonishing array of hits, many of which have become cultural touchstones. Expect to hear his iconic compositions performed live, such as "Wichita Lineman," a perennial favorite famously recorded by Glen Campbell, known for its evocative imagery and profound emotional depth. Other masterpieces like "By the Time I Get to Phoenix" and "Galveston" are also likely to feature, showcasing his unparalleled ability to craft narratives within song. "MacArthur Park," an epic and theatrical composition, and "Up, Up and Away," a joyous anthem for The 5th Dimension, further exemplify the breadth and versatility of his genius. The Katharine Hepburn Cultural Arts Center, affectionately known as The Kate, stands as a beacon of artistic excellence and community engagement in Old Saybrook, CT. Named in honor of the legendary actress Katharine Hepburn, who made her home in Old Saybrook for many years, the venue embodies a spirit of elegance, intimacy, and profound artistic commitment. The venue itself, originally built in 1946 as the Old Saybrook Town Hall and movie theater, underwent a meticulous restoration to preserve its classic charm while integrating modern amenities.
